Output 56df5fa980f21e70e23afc2faa7c51a064e15e07c33f44e672f8184a440be7de:0

value
72800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aa014b94d16cacb9d34908078e0f9e9583f2fd OP_EQUAL
address
3ELCqB6rBfXA32bJyhPndtwqJmPRC7nyvM
transaction
56df5fa980f21e70e23afc2faa7c51a064e15e07c33f44e672f8184a440be7de
confirmations
284722
spent
true